UNAIR Students Win Silver and Bronze Medal ONMIPA-PT 2018

UNAIR NEWS “ Another national achievement was made by 51¶¯Âþ students.This time, two students of “Blue-Yellow” campus won a medal in the National Olympiad of Mathematics and Natural Sciences of Higher Education (ONMIPA PT) 2018 held by Directorate of Student Affairs, Directorate General of Learning and Student Affairs, Kemenristekdikti, at University of Muhammadiyah Malang, 4-7 May 2018.

The two UNAIR students were Ihsan Fahmi Rofanada who won a Silver Medal in Biology, while Nando Reza Pratama won a Bronze Medal in Chemistry.Both are students of the second and fourth semesters of Faculty of Medicine (FK) UNAIR.

In ONMIPA 2018 in Malang, UNAIR qualifies five students in three fields (physics, chemistry, and biology) in the selection of Region VII (East Java) level.They are Ihsan Fahmi Rofanada, Nando Reza Pratama, Agnessia Asian Budi Setyo (all three from FK) and two from FST namely Brilliana and Beni Hamdani.In the field of Mathematics, UNAIR ambassador did not qualify in East Java level.The number of representatives to ONMIPA this year was the same as last year.

On Monday, May 7 afternoon, upon arrival from Malang, accompanied by Director of Student Affairs UNAIR Dr.M. Hadi Shubhan, SH., MH., CN., UNAIR representatives were received by UNAIR Vice Rector II Dr.Muhammad Madyan, SE., M.Si., M.Fin., on behalf of UNAIR Rector in the Hall of Rector™s Office Fourth Floor.

Dr.Muh Madyan had great hopes that achievement can be improved in ONMIPA competition in 2019 as the representatives are still eligible to compete in 2019 and coaching from the team of supervisors from Faculty of Science and Technology (FST) still conducted and coordinated by student affairs directorate.

Director of Student Affairs Dr.M. Hadi Shubhan, SH., MH., CN., said that it was a great improvement, at least when it was compared to last year in Semarang.They managed to get two medals from five delegates sent to the competition.

Hadi Shubhan continued that potential students for Olympiad participants in UNAIR are evenly distributed in several faculties.They are not only from Faculty of Science and Technology (FST).Therefore, the Directorate of Student Affairs will explore the potential through coaching.

“The prospective olympiad participants at UNAIR are many, but they are still apathetic to join the competition, so it is our duty to nurture them.Fortunately, we always ask freshmen write acurriculum vitae (CV), from the CV we™ll know who of them joined OSN (National Science Olympiad) and we can coach them, “said Pak Hadi, his nickname.

“At UNAIR there is also a bond of ONMIPA alumni, so the alumni of OSN (from senior high school –ed) will also be coached and developed for the next event,” said Director of Student Affairs.M. Hadi Shubhan.(*)
